لغات البرمجة

لغة التجميع x86: نظرة عامة

لغة التجميع x86 هي جزء من عائلة لغات التجميع المتوافقة مع الوراء، والتي توفر مستوى من التوافق يمتد حتى إلى معالجات Intel 8008 التي تم إطلاقها في أبريل 1972. تستخدم لغات التجميع x86 لإنتاج رمز كائن لفئة معالجات x86. مثل جميع لغات التجميع، تستخدم معرفات قصيرة لتمثيل التعليمات الأساسية التي يمكن لوحدة المعالجة المركزية في الكمبيوتر فهمها واتباعها. في بعض الأحيان، تُنتج المترجمات رمز تجميع كخطوة وسيطة عند ترجمة برنامج عالي المستوى إلى رمز الآلة. تعتبر كتابة التجميع لغة برمجة ذات مستوى من الجهازية والتفصيل، حيث يتم استخدام لغات التجميع بشكل أكثر شيوعًا لتطبيقات مفصلة وحساسة للوقت مثل الأنظمة المضمنة في الوقت الحقيقي الصغيرة أو أنظمة تشغيل النواة وبرامج تشغيل الأجهزة.

وتتميز لغة التجميع x86 بالعديد من الميزات والخصائص، بما في ذلك القدرة على العمل مع التعليقات والانحواءات البصرية. تعتبر التعليقات جزءًا مهمًا من كتابة التعليمات لتوضيح الغرض والوظيفة التي تقوم بها كل تعليمة. كما يتميز بوجود تعليقات السطر التي تسمح بإضافة توضيحات إلى نهاية السطر. العديد من لغات التجميع x86 تستخدم رمز “;” كرمز للتعليقات على مستوى السطر.

يمكن العثور على معلومات إضافية حول لغة التجميع x86 في مصادر مثل ويكيبيديا على الرابط التالي: لغة التجميع x86 في ويكيبيديا.